What’s on the Ballot?
APRIL 7, 2026 BALLOT LANGUAGE: Shall the Gillett School District be authorized to exceed state revenue limits on a non-recurring basis by $2,000,000 in the 2026-2027 school year; $2,800,000 in the 2027-2028 school year; $3,200,000 in the 2028-2029 school year; $3,700,000 in the 2029-2030 school year; and $4,300,000 in the 2030-2031 school year, for nonrecurring purposes, with such revenues used to maintain the District’s instructional programs and operations?
